For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public high schools serving 120 students in Sanborn County, SD.
The top-ranked public high schools in Sanborn County, SD are Sanborn Central High School - 01 and Woonsocket High School - 01.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Sanborn County, SD public high schools have an average math proficiency score of 36% (versus the South Dakota public high school average of 40%), and reading proficiency score of 50% (versus the 63% statewide average). High schools in Sanborn County have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of South Dakota public high schools.
Sanborn County, SD public high school have a Graduation Rate of 68%, which is less than the South Dakota average of 82%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Woonsocket High School - 01, with ≥80%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in South Dakota or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 11%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the South Dakota public high school average of 35% (majority American Indian).
